Deputation Of PDD Daily Wagers Met Sham Lal Sharma
Submitted Memorandum Chalking Out Various Demands

Jammu,July 12 (Scoop News)-A Deputation of PDL/TDL Daily Wagers Of Power development Department(PDD)called on Shri Sham Lal Sharma, former minister and BJP leader today. During the interaction , the deputation apprised of Mr Sharma about the various problems confronted by them. The glaring issue which they brought up was the discrimination between them and the valley employees.
There are about 735 employees in the pdd department having seven years service have since become eligible for promotion to the graded scale but have not yet been granted the same However it is astonishing that the employees belonging to Valley and are similarly placed have been considered for promotion having seniority upto 2012. However, in the case of such employees belonging to Jammu Region, out of 735 employees, only 200 plus are being considered for promotion under SRO 381.
It is not the first time when there has not been gross discrimination with the Jammu Region may it be selection of candidates for various posts , distribution of funds for various development works etc etc.
Shri Sharma expressed great anguish over the discrimination and said that all the three regions are equally governed by uniformed rules and policies. He expressed his concern on regularisation of pdd employees having seniority upto 2012 belonging to Kashmir Region have since been regularised but the fate of similar placed employees of Jammu Region is still hanging in balance.
Shri Sham Lal Sharma spoke to higher authorities of the department and asked them as to why there is discrimination between employees of two regions who are governed with uniform rules and regulations. He further urged them to look into this case and other similar cases
